Heesoo Kim (South Korean, b. 1984) is a contemporary painter based in Seoul. He graduated from Konkuk University with a BFA in Advertising and Design, and began his professional career in photography and video. At the age of 30, Kim transitioned to painting, seeking a medium that allowed for deeper introspection and personal expression.
Kim’s work centers on the emotional nuances of everyday life, often depicting anonymous figures in moments of quiet reflection. His paintings are characterised by bold lines, flattened perspectives, and earthy tones, creating a sense of stillness and melancholy. The recurring theme of “Normal Life” in his exhibitions underscores his focus on the universal aspects of human experience.
Figurative paintings are a powerful testament to an artist's ability to convey their vision and connect with audiences. Korean artist Heesoo Kim excels in this realm, creating works that are instantly recognisable and profoundly evocative.
Heesoo captures the emotions he observes in people, translating them onto his characters in a way that makes their expressions neutral. This unique approach invites viewers to project their own feelings onto each piece. For instance, in this painting, if you’re missing someone, you might feel the ache of longing; if you’re in love, the world may seem to revolve around those two lovers depicted.
His work accommodates the myriad emotions that viewers bring, allowing each person to experience something entirely on their own. What feelings arise for you when you see his art? It’s an invitation to write your own story.
